Irvin D. Hamline, 99, of Galesburg, passed away peacefully on Thursday, January 5, 2022, at 7:20 PM at Seminary Manor, Galesburg.

Irvin was born on November 12, 1923, in Gross, Kansas. He was the son of Roy and Mary Ann (Evans) Hamline. He married Doris Willison on February 11, 1949, in East Galesburg. Together they celebrated 61 years of marriage before she preceded him in death on October 31, 2010. Irvin is survived by his son, Brian (Deanne) Hamline of Galesburg; sister, Carolyn Parker of Moline; sister-in-law, Jean Hamline of East Galesburg. He was also preceded in death by his parents and two brothers.

Irvin attended Knoxville schools. He was a World War II Veteran, serving in the European Theatre from 1943-1946. After his tour in the service, Irvin worked at Purington Brick Co., Rowe Manufacturing, and the Galesburg Community School District 205.

Cremation rites will be accorded. Graveside services will be held at 2:00 PM, on Saturday, April 29, 2023, at the Knoxville Cemetery, Knoxville. Military rites will be conducted at the graveside.
